Architecting Innovations in ONF’s, OMEC, and Ather

GS Lab is an architect, maintainer, and contributor for OMEC & Aether projects. We have contributed to OMEC’s Control plane (SGW, PGW) and User plane (SGW, PGW) along with contributions for MME, HSS, Database, PCRF, CTF, CDF, and SGXCDR modules.

OMEC is the 1st fully featured and scalable open-source EPC built for high performance. It is designed to be used as a standalone EPC with both mobile and fixed subscriber management functions. It is designed to handle the huge inflow of new devices coming online because of 5G and IoT expansion.

Aether is an open-source platform optimized for multi-cloud deployments, and it simultaneously supports wireless devices over licensed, unlicensed, and lightly licensed (CBRS) spectrum.

Aether is the first open-source Enterprise 5G/LTE Edge-Cloud-as-a-Service platform (ECaaS). It provides mobile connectivity and edge cloud services for distributed enterprise networks, all provisioned and managed from a centralized cloud.

Octopus – vEPC compliance tracker

Octopus is a complete & automated vEPC testing tool that reduces your vEPC testing time from days to minutes. It’s a comprehensive testing tool that works across various EPCs with different components and protocols. Octopus works with test traffic generators, detects and pinpoints failures for compliance. It also helps you trace all the messages at each connection point.

5G-in-a-Box

5G-in-a-box is your all in one vEPC sandbox designed to accelerate ONF’s OMEC deployment and testing across any infrastructure (Cloud, Virtual or Bare metal). It is a single click easy to deploy, open sourced sandbox which can be easily extended to any private vEPCs.
